What kind of wine it is
J. Hofstatter Vigna Kolbenhof Gewurztraminer is an aromatic white wine from Alto Adige. In the glass, it displays an intense yellow colour with bright greenish highlights. On the nose, aromas of peach and apricot intertwine with exotic notes of lychee, mango and passion fruit. On the palate, the concentration of fruit is perfectly balanced by a delicate acidity, which gives balance and agility to the sip. Its persistence makes it ideal to pair with spicy Asian cuisine or refined dishes such as foie gras.
Where it comes from
This wine originates in Termeno, the result of a selection within the Kolbenhof estate, a benchmark plot for Gewürztraminer in Alto Adige thanks to its microclimate and ideal exposure. The vines sink their roots into soils composed of clay and calcareous gravel, elements that give the wine a precise structure and a well-defined flavour profile. The mention Vigna highlights the inseparable link with the single vineyard of origin, a value that J. Hofstatter has cultivated with dedication since 1907.
How it is produced
The production process begins with a gentle crushing of the grapes; the must remains in contact with the skins for several hours to fully extract the varietal characteristics. This is followed by soft pressing, natural clarification and fermentation at a controlled temperature. Maturation takes place exclusively in stainless steel, where the wine rests on the lees for seven months to preserve its expressive purity. A brief ageing in the cellar then precedes release, completing a profile of great elegance.
History and Curiosities
Since 1907, in Termeno, J. Hofstätter has infused the Vigna Kolbenhof Gewürztraminer with the winemaking expertise of five generations. The excellence of this wine originates from a single vineyard, recognised as one of the most prestigious crus of Alto Adige DOC. Thanks to the vision of oenologist Martin Foradori Hofstätter, the Vigna designation guarantees absolute fidelity to the territory of origin, enhancing a distinctive and authentic identity.
